Photographer
Photographers capture images for events or clients, specialising in various styles while using creative techniques and equipment to meet briefs.
Wedding Photographer
A Wedding Photographer captures photos during ceremonies and receptions, edits images, and collaborates with couples to meet their photography needs.
Fashion Photographer
A Fashion Photographer captures images of models wearing clothing or accessories, collaborates with clients, and uses creative techniques to edit photos.
Portrait Photographer
A Portrait Photographer captures high-quality images of individuals or groups, tailoring shoots to client needs and using various techniques and equipment.
Sports Photographer
A Sports Photographer captures images at sporting events for media or clubs, specialising in action shots and working flexible hours.
Event Photographer
An Event Photographer captures high-quality images at events like weddings and corporate functions, liaises with clients, and edits final photos.
Product Photographer
A Product Photographer captures high-quality product images for media, collaborates with clients, and edits photos to enhance branding.
